
T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- PT Garuda Indonesia (Persero) Tbk. has announced plans to purchase 50 Boeing aircraft from the United States as part of its long-term strategy.
Vice President Corporate Secretary Cahyadi Indrananto said one of the company’s key strategic goals is to expand its fleet to 120 aircraft over the next five years.
“The long-term strategy is to optimize routes and expand the network to meet high demand, one of which is to increase the fleet to about 120 aircraft and open up to 100 routes in the next five years,” Cahyadi told Tempo on Monday, July 21, 2025.
Cahyadi also welcomed the agreement between President Prabowo Subianto and U.S. President Donald Trump on reciprocal tariffs. As part of the 19 percent tariff deal, Indonesia is required to purchase 50 Boeing aircraft from the U.S.
“This is in line with the company’s long-term strategy,” he said.
According to Garuda Indonesia’s official website, the airline currently operates a total of 77 aircraft. The fleet includes Boeing 777-300ER, Boeing 737-800NG, Airbus A330-200, Airbus A330-300, and Airbus A330-900neo models.
“As of May 31, 2025, the average age of our fleet is 13.06 years,” the website states.
Despite the ambitious plan, Garuda Indonesia is still working to secure funding for the aircraft purchase. Cahyadi said the company is in ongoing discussions with several potential financiers, and some parties have shown interest.
“Some parties have shown interest in providing funding,” he noted.
However, he declined to provide further details, citing the ongoing nature of the discussions.
“Since this is a work in progress, I cannot provide the details yet, but hopefully the process will be smooth and we will announce it at the earliest opportunity,” he added.
